As a Analyst, MENA & Türkiye Junior Economist in the EMEA team, you will support the coverage of the MENA economies. You will support the analysis of economic trends, produce comprehensive macroeconomic forecasts, and track policy developments by central banks and fiscal authorities. You will collaborate with colleagues to highlight regional and cross-country themes, publish regular client notes, and participate in calls, investor trips, and conferences.
Job Responsibilities:
- Analyze macroeconomic, financial, and policy drivers of various economies, with a focus on emerging and frontier markets
- Support J.P. Morgan clients with bespoke analysis in timely manner
- Organize investor trips, webinars, and conferences
- Develop, maintain, and enhance econometric and quantitative models for forecasting, scenario analysis, and policy evaluation
- Prepare Excel charts, Word documents, and PowerPoint presentations for publications and meetings
- Manage, clean, and analyze large and complex datasets using tools such as Python to manipulate and analyze macroeconomic data, producing charts, tables, and publications
- Find, read, and summarize information such as news articles, academic research, and data documentation
- Contribute to the automation and improvement of research processes, ensuring data integrity and reproducibility

JPMorgan Chase & Co. (NYSE: JPM) is a leading global financial services firm with assets of $3.7 trillion and operations worldwide. The firm is a leader in investment banking, financial services for consumers and small businesses, commercial banking, financial transaction processing, and asset management. A component of the Dow Jones Industrial Average, JPMorgan Chase & Co. serves millions of consumers in the United States and many of the world’s most prominent corporate, institutional and government clients under its J.P.
